e. Measure Mode Display
The Measure Mode is the normal mode of
operation. In this mode, the Display will
show the current gas measurement, the
component of interest, the current opera-
tions of the softkeys, and several graph-
ics. A bar representing the displayed
concentration is shown as a percent of
fullscale and up to four lines showing user
selectable secondary parameters from
either the Analyzer module or any I/O
module bound to it. See the Platform
manual for information as to how to select
these. The Measure Mode display is
shown in Figure 3-5.
If more than one Analyzer module is con-
nected to the system, an additional Run
Mode display will show as many as four
(five for version 2.3 and later) gas meas-
urements on the display screen.

f. Main Menu
Pressing Main… (F3) or the key while
in any single component display will bring
up the Main Menu (Figure 3-6). From the
Main menu it is possible to change all op-
erating values of the Analyzer to set up
and control the parameters of measure-
ment, calibration and data transfer.
From the Main menu, the F5 key (MFG
Data) will access several submenus
showing the manufacturing and version
data of the Analyzer as shown in Figure
3-7.
Selection from the Main menu:
Measure (F1) – Changes to the single
component display of the current channel.
See Section 3-6a.
Status… (F2) – Changes to the “Current
measurement parameters” menu of the
current channel. See Section 3-6.
Channel (F3) – Scrolls through all chan-
nels of the connected Analyzers and
Analyzer modules.
Lock… (F4) – Locks any operating level
by security code. See Section 6-7.
MFG Data (F5) – Changes to “Module
Manufacturing Data” menu. See Figure
3-7.
